I've either lost my mind or an alien has invaded my body. I've decided to make Wednesdays technology free. No TV. No video games. No computer (aside from work-related things). Those who know me well realize this is a huge step. I think I was born a TVaholic. I'm also a large fan of computers and the internet. So, I'm sure you're just dying to know how I came to this conclusion? It was our last morning at the lake. I was lounging with Ray on the couch with my cup of tea. Then, Lily woke up and came and snuggled me. Everything was quiet and serene and I was trying to figure out how to capture that feeling at home. I came to the conclusion that technology was our problem. Our TV is on pretty much all waking hours. We only have one TV at the lake and that's in the kids' bedroom. There's no cable, just movies, and its mainly used when the weather is poor or at bedtime. We do have my mom's laptop with internet but its a pretty small distraction. Instead, we spend our days fishing, boating, playing cards & games, reading, and enjoying each other's company.
I broke the news to the kids today. They freaked out at first until I started listing off all the alternative things we could do: go for walks, bike rides, swimming, to the beach, play cards, play games, etc. Now, they seem pretty excited.
